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
69 341253745 784120576 9430
2103968 6661571 753037442
2103968 6661571 753037442
9972212266 92 06470775309
All about undefined
Interested in learning more?
2103968 6661571 753037442
9972212266 92 06470775309
See more
073026959 18676
1139077 8388835 12044624849 522374
See more
3561 915680047
77490 018 19116 99 28
See more